In 2024, Spain`s prescription sunglass market witnessed a notable increase in imports. The trend indicated a growing demand for high-quality eyewear products. This surge in imports suggests a shift towards premium and specialized eyewear among Spanish consumers.

The Spain Prescription Sunglass Market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ing awareness about eye health and the popularity of fashion-forward eyewear. Consumers are increasingly opting for prescription sunglasses to combine vision correction with UV protection and style. Key players in the market are focusing on offering a wide range of designs, materials, and lens options to cater to diverse consumer preferences. Additionally, the growing trend of online shopping for eyewear is expanding the market reach and accessibility for consumers. The market is characterized by intense competition, with major players leveraging innovative technologies and marketing strategies to differentiate their products. Overall, the Spain Prescription Sunglass Market is poised for further growth as consumers prioritize both functionality and fashion in their eyewear choices.

In the Spain Prescription Sunglass Market, one of the main challenges faced is the competition from non-prescription sunglasses. Consumers often prioritize fashion and style over functionality, leading them to choose standard sunglasses over prescription ones. Additionally, the perception that prescription sunglasses are more expensive can deter potential buyers. Another challenge is the lack of awareness and education about the benefits of prescription sunglasses in protecting eye health from harmful UV rays. This limits the market potential as many consumers may not fully understand the importance of investing in prescription sunglasses. Overcoming these challenges requires effective marketing strategies to highlight the unique advantages of prescription sunglasses, such as improved vision and eye protection, as well as offering competitive pricing to make them more accessible to a wider audience.

In Spain, the prescription sunglass market is regulated by government policies that require individuals to obtain a prescription from a licensed optometrist or ophthalmologist before purchasing prescription sunglasses. This ensures that consumers receive proper eye care and vision correction tailored to their specific needs. Additionally, the government sets standards for the quality and safety of prescription sunglasses to protect consumers from potential harm. Compliance with these regulations is enforced by regulatory authorities to maintain the integrity of the market and safeguard public health. Overall, government policies in Spain aim to promote responsible consumption of prescription sunglasses and prioritize the well-being of consumers through strict adherence to prescription requirements and quality standards.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
